Where Do Women Stand in the IoT Security Revolution?

Women are leading in IoT security, bringing innovative solutions to cybersecurity challenges. Despite being underrepresented, their unique insights are crucial in protecting connected devices. They're influential in education, advocacy, and narrowing the gender gap through mentorship and leadership. As innovators, they develop secure IoT technologies, prioritize privacy, and advocate for ethical standards. Facing gender bias head-on, they inspire change and serve as role models, encouraging more women to enter STEM and cybersecurity fields.

Pioneers in the Field

Women are increasingly becoming pioneers in the Internet of Things (IoT) security. With their diverse perspectives, women are leading innovative approaches to tackle security challenges, including designing secure IoT frameworks, developing encryption technologies, and implementing robust policies to safeguard devices and networks against cyber threats.

Underrepresented Yet Influential

Despite being underrepresented in the tech industry, women play a crucial role in the IoT security revolution. Their involvement brings unique insights and solutions to cybersecurity challenges, pushing the boundaries of what's possible in protecting connected devices and ecosystems from malicious attacks.

Leaders in Education and Advocacy

Women are at the forefront of educating and advocating for better security measures in the IoT space. They lead initiatives and programs aimed at raising awareness about the importance of cybersecurity, influencing policy, and inspiring the next generation of women to pursue careers in tech and cybersecurity.

Bridging the Gender Gap in Cybersecurity

While the gender gap in cybersecurity is still notable, women in IoT security are playing a key role in narrowing it. Through mentorship programs, networking events, and leadership roles, women are creating more opportunities for themselves and others, shaping a more inclusive future for the industry.

Innovators in Secure IoT Development

Women in the IoT security field are not just participants; they are innovators. They contribute significantly to developing secure IoT devices and applications, employing cutting-edge technologies and methodologies to ensure the safety and privacy of users.

Champions of Privacy and Ethical Standards

Women in IoT security are also champions of privacy and ethical standards. They often lead the conversation on the ethical implications of IoT technologies, pushing for regulations and standards that prioritize user privacy and data protection in an increasingly connected world.

Facing Challenges Head-On

Women in IoT security face numerous challenges, including gender bias and lack of representation. However, they confront these obstacles head-on, demonstrating resilience, expertise, and leadership that inspire change and progress within the industry.

Networking and Collaboration Powerhouses

Through various platforms and organizations, women in IoT security are creating strong networks and collaboration opportunities. These communities support women’s career growth, offer mentorship, and facilitate discussions on important security issues, enhancing their impact on the industry.

Research and Development Leaders

Women are leading significant research and development efforts in IoT security. Their work in universities, think tanks, and the private sector is pushing the boundaries of knowledge, leading to safer IoT ecosystems and technologies that benefit society as a whole.

Role Models for Future Generations

Finally, women in the IoT security space serve as role models for future generations. Their achievements and leadership demonstrate that women have a vital role to play in shaping the future of technology and cybersecurity, encouraging more young women to enter STEM fields and contribute to technological advancements.
